Як надмірно складний код ускладнює Ethereum: заклик Бутеріна до більш зрозумілих протоколів

robot
Генерація анотацій у процесі

Поточний стан Ethereum демонструє глибокий парадокс. У міру зростання мережі та розвитку функцій стає все важче для звичайного розробника зрозуміти її цілком. Віталік Бутерін, співзасновник Ethereum, поставив критичне питання: якщо наша мета — “не довіряти, а перевіряти”, як ми можемо перевірити, якщо система настільки складна, що ніхто не може її зрозуміти?

Проблема надмірної складності

Основу блокчейну складає проста ідея: код має бути прозорим і перевіряємим будь-ким. Але протокол Ethereum досяг такого рівня, що лише кілька людей справді розуміють його цілком від початку до кінця.

Це створює сектор, наповнений експертами, яких небагато. Більшість розробників і користувачів покладаються на довіру до тих, хто керує системою, вважаючи, що вони знають, що роблять. У такій ситуації справжня децентралізація стає лише мрією. Мережа стає залежною від кількох осіб, здатних читати та аудитувати код, що, хоча й вражає, не є справжньою безпекою без довіри.

Чому код має бути доступним

За думкою Бутеріна, рішення полягає у зменшенні бар’єрів для розуміння. Чим простіший протокол, тим більше людей зможуть створювати ключі для моніторингу та пошуку вразливостей. Це відкриває можливості для ширшої спільноти — долучатися, аудитувати та пропонувати покращення.

Переваги очевидні: більше очей на коді означає швидше виявлення вразливостей, кращу безпеку та вищу якість розробки. Такий підхід до сучасності та якості може стати ключем до справжньої децентралізації.

Модель Tinygrad: секрет ясності

Бутерін слідує моделі tinygrad, фреймворку глибокого навчання, відомого своєю стратегією: найкоротший код — найкращий код. Ця філософія стверджує, що обмеження сприяють ясності та елегантності.

Його бачення Ethereum схоже: протокол має бути настільки простим, щоб будь-хто з серйозним розумінням міг умістити всю його ментальну модель у голові. Це не лише пріоритет у інженерії; це пріоритет у демократії мережі.

До майбутнього зрозумілого Ethereum

Зараз виклик у тому, як зменшити складність Ethereum, зберігаючи його функціональність і безпеку. Це не просто інженерне завдання; це випробування відданості справжній децентралізації. Інвестиції у спрощення протоколу — це інвестиції у майбутнє блокчейн-технологій, що базуються на довірі та доступні для всіх.

ETH0,51%
Переглянути оригінал
Ця сторінка може містити контент третіх осіб, який надається виключно в інформаційних цілях (не в якості запевнень/гарантій) і не повинен розглядатися як схвалення його поглядів компанією Gate, а також як фінансова або професійна консультація. Див. Застереження для отримання детальної інформації.
  • Нагородити
  • Прокоментувати
  • Репост
  • Поділіться
Прокоментувати
0/400
Немає коментарів
  • Закріпити